Rascal
by Sterling North (read by Jim Weiss) is an autobiographical story about the author's life with his pet raccoon.

Eleven-year-old Sterling found Rascal - a mischievous, intelligent, and most engaging young raccoon - in a hollow stump in the woods. Adopted into a household that included Sterling's absentminded father, four skunks, woodchucks, a crow named Poe, and half finished 18-foot canoe in the living room. Rascal became Stelring's constant companion - and ate, slept, and even went to school with him.

Set in 1918, this is a wonderful story about a child and his pet. Sterling is a very independent and  resourceful young man who learns valuable life lessons during his year with Rascal.

Unabridged. 3 cassettes (not available on CD). Length: 4 hours, 41 minutes.
